Severin and Vinegar Syndrome in particular seem to have perfected this practice, especially with their Black Friday limited editions (apparently the speed of the sell-out of Vinegar's MAUSOLEUM took even them by surprise!). In earlier years, I rarely bit on these, opting to hope that enough copies would remain until a subsequent sale brought the prices down, which often happened, or just holding off until the "standard" editions. Now I seem to have drank the kool-aid and have a hard time resisting prestige treatments of old gems like these. I'm surprised more boutique labels haven't adopted this practice as it seems increasingly like a real marketing win, depending on the titles unearthed. I've seen and/or owned previous versions of the Blood Island films and get a kick out of all of them, and still never thought this set would sell out that fast.

Terror is a Man features a DTS-HD Master Audio 2.0 mono track whose harshness in the higher frequencies is noticeable right up front courtesy of pretty loud hiss underlying the otherwise "silent" warning title card. Hiss only increases once the credits and score begin, and the very highest string cues actually were almost painful for me, though that said, midrange and low end sounded relatively full bodied. The track continues to have various minor issues like occasional pops and cracks, with dialogue coming through well enough, but what is really problematic is a very loud buzz that shows up and almost overtakes the track at around 54:40, continuing on for quite a while thereafter. It's actually under the big "gimmick" moment of the film, the bell ringing conceit. I actually wondered if this was supposed to be a sound effect for the lab scenes, but it continues under scenes that are far removed from that setting.
So, in short it appears that all copies have this buzz.

Though best known for their legendary BLOOD ISLAND Trilogy, the Philippine/U.S. production/distribution company Hemisphere Pictures was also responsible for some of the most provocative and insane films of the ‘60s and ‘70s drive-in/grindhouse era. THE BLOOD DRINKERS and CURSE OF THE VAMPIRES are the still-potent masterpieces from The Father of Philippine Horror Gerry de Leon. BRAIN OF BLOOD is the all-star Grade Z classic from infamous exploitation auteur Al Adamson. THE BLACK CAT and TORTURE CHAMBER OF DR. SADISM – starring Christopher Lee and Tarzan – are Hemisphere’s two most extreme acquisitions for the company’s notorious double-feature packages.
